Lemon-Blueberry Cheesecake

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Chilling Time 8 hours
Total Time 9 hours 30 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 12 slices
Calories 350 kcal

Equipment

  • Mixing bowl
  • Springform pan
  • Medium saucepan

Ingredients
  

For the Crust

  • 1 can Cooking Spray Prevents sticking
  • 14 pieces Graham Crackers, finely crushed For crust
  • 1/2 cup Unsalted Butter, melted Binds crust ingredients
  • 1/3 cup Granulated Sugar Sweetness
  • 1/4 tsp Kosher Salt Enhances flavor

For the Cheesecake Filling

  • 4 blocks Cream Cheese, room temperature Creamy base
  • 1 cup Granulated Sugar Sweetens the filling
  • 3 large Eggs Adds structure
  • 1 Tbsp Finely Grated Lemon Zest Citrus flavor
  • 1/4 cup Fresh Lemon Juice Balances sweetness
  • 3 Tbsp All-Purpose Flour Stabilizes cheesecake
  • 1 tsp Pure Vanilla Extract Adds depth
  • 1 1/2 cups Fresh Blueberries For filling

For the Blueberry Sauce

  • 2 cups Fresh Blueberries For topping
  • 2 Tbsp Cornstarch Thickens sauce

For Serving

  • 1 cup Whipped Cream For topping
  • 1/2 pieces Lemon, sliced Optional garnish

Instructions
 

Crust Preparation

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a mixing bowl, combine finely crushed graham crackers, sugar, and melted butter. Press into the bottom of a springform pan and bake for 10 minutes until golden.

Filling Preparation

  • In a large bowl, beat cream cheese until smooth. Gradually mix in sugar, adding eggs one at a time. Stir in lemon zest, lemon juice, flour, and vanilla extract until well combined.
  • Gently fold in 1 ½ cups of fresh blueberries into your cheesecake batter.

Baking

  • Pour the filling over the baked crust. Bake in the preheated oven for 55-60 minutes, until the center is set but slightly jiggles.

Cooling and Chilling

  • Allow cheesecake to cool for about an hour. Refrigerate for at least 8 hours or overnight.

Blueberry Sauce

  • In a medium saucepan, combine remaining blueberries, sugar, cornstarch, and lemon juice. Cook over medium heat for about 4 minutes until thickened.

Serving

  • Release the cheesecake from the springform pan and slice. Top each slice with warm blueberry sauce and whipped cream.

Notes

Ensure ingredients are at room temperature for the best texture. Avoid overmixing to prevent cracks during baking. Chill for at least 8 hours for optimal flavor.
